This class, developed by Professors Bill Ristenpart and Tonya Kuhl, was designed to better engage a diverse population of students and stoke excitement around engineering. Today more than 1500 students per year take the class that’s been voted the most popular elective course on campus.

WFC 050— Natural History of California's Wild Vertebrates(3 units) Course Description: Examination of the natural history of California's wild vertebrates (fish, amphibians, reptiles, birds, and mammals), including their biogeography, systematics, ecology and conservation status. Learning Activities: Lecture 2 hour (s), Discussion 1 hour (s).AST 010L— Observational Astronomy Lab(1 unit) Course Description: Introduction to observations of the night sky using small telescopes in nighttime laboratory. Learning Activities: Laboratory 2.50 hour (s). Credit Limitation (s): Not open for credit to students who have taken AST 002 or AST 010.
